Applauded - definition, pronunciation, transcription

*
Amer.  |əˈplɒdəd|  American pronunciation of the word applauded
Brit.  |əˈplɔːdɪd|  British pronunciation of the word applauded
- this word is a past tense form of the verbto applaud
- this word is a past participle form of the verbto applaud

Extra examples

Everyone applauded the graduates as they entered the auditorium.

The audience stood and applauded her performance.

Rather than being criticized for her honesty, she should be applauded for it.

We stood and applauded as the parade went by.

John applauded my decision.

The crowd applauded, whooping and whistling.

The audience applauded.

The audience applauded loudly.

A crowd of 300 supporters warmly applauded her speech.

She should be applauded for her honesty.

The new official was warmly applauded.
